Insurance Investment Operations
A significant portion of AIG’s General Insurance and Life Insurance & Retirement Services revenues are derived
from AIG’s insurance investment operations. The following table summarizes the investment results of the
insurance operations:

General Insurance:
2008 .......................... $ 9,766 $111,435 $121,201 2.9% 3.1%
2007 . ......................... 5,874 117,050 122,924 5.0 5.2
2006 . ......................... 3,201 102,231 105,432 5.4 5.6
2005 . ......................... 2,450 86,211 88,661 4.5 4.7
2004 . ......................... 2,012 73,338 75,350 4.2 4.4
Life Insurance & Retirement Services:
2008 .......................... $29,278 $385,980 $415,258 2.4% 2.6%
2007 . ......................... 25,926 423,743 449,669 5.0 5.3
2006 . ......................... 13,698 392,348 406,046 4.9 5.1
2005 . ......................... 11,137 356,839 367,976 5.1 5.2
2004 . ......................... 7,737 309,627 317,364 4.9 5.1
(a) Including investment income due and accrued and real estate. Also, includes collateral assets invested under
the securities lending program.
(b) Net investment income divided by the annual average sum of cash and invested assets.
(c) Net investment income divided by the annual average invested assets.
AIG’s worldwide insurance investment policy places primary emphasis on investments in government and
fixed income securities in all of its portfolios and, to a lesser extent, investments in high-yield bonds, common
stocks, real estate, hedge funds and other alternative investments, in order to enhance returns on policyholders’
funds and generate net investment income. The ability to implement this policy is somewhat limited in certain
territories as there may be a lack of attractive long-term investment opportunities or investment restrictions may be
imposed by the local regulatory authorities.
Financial Services Operations
AIG’s Financial Services subsidiaries engage in diversified activities including aircraft leasing, capital
markets, consumer finance and insurance premium finance. Together, the Aircraft Leasing, Capital Markets
and Consumer Finance operations generate the majority of the revenues produced by the Financial Services
operations. A.I. Credit also contributes to Financial Services results principally by providing insurance premium
financing for both AIG’s policyholders and those of other insurers.
Aircraft Leasing
AIG’s Aircraft Leasing operations are the operations of ILFC, which generates its revenues primarily from
leasing new and used commercial jet aircraft to foreign and domestic airlines. Revenues also result from the
remarketing of commercial jet aircraft for ILFC’s own account, and remarketing and fleet management services for
airlines and financial institutions. See also Note 3 to Consolidated Financial Statements.
